Program Requirements

Bachelor of Science in Nursing is required.

Possess Minnesota Registered Nurse License.

Complete one year of nursing experience in a critical patient care setting within the last three years. Not accepted: Operating Room, Emergency Room, Post Anesthesia Recovery, or Ground/flight transport.

Cumulative grade point average of 3.0 or greater.

Certifications are not required for application. Required prior to entrance into the program: BLS (Basic Life Support), ACLS (Advanced Cardiac Life Support), and PALS (Pediatric Advanced Life Support).

Must have taken College Chemistry within the past five years.
